2011 FKP to CRC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2011

During 2011, the FKP to CRC ex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on April 29, valuing the pair at 830.3066.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 26, dropping to 769.8111.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 60.4955 CRC.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 792.9989 to the December average rate of 782.0844, the exchange rate registered a net change of -1.38%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2011 high of 830.3066 was down 9.95% compared to the 2010 peak of 922.0104,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 806.7972, compared to 803.0035 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 3.7937 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2011 was November, with a trading range of 49.6244 CRC (High: 819.4356 / Low: 769.8111). On the other end, February was the most stable month, with a tight range of 10.6076 CRC (High: 809.1345 / Low: 798.5269).

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between January and April,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 3 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between August and September, when the average rate fell by 22.6916 points.
